Farm Service Agency
The Farm Service Agency (FSA) is a branch of the U.S. Department of Agriculture dedicated to supporting farmers and ranchers through various programs and services. With a focus on financial assistance, disaster recovery, and conservation efforts, the FSA aims to enhance agricultural productivity and sustainability.
In addition to providing loans and income support, the FSA offers educational resources and outreach initiatives to help new and existing agricultural producers navigate their options. The agency is committed to fostering a robust agricultural sector by facilitating access to essential programs and assistance tailored to the needs of the farming community.
